C#string去空格
时间: 2023-10-01 16:03:51 浏览: 38
在C#中,可以使用Trim()方法将字符串中的空格去掉。例如:
```
string str = " hello world ";
string trimmedStr = str.Trim();
```
在上面的代码中,Trim()方法将字符串str中前后的空格去掉,将结果存储在trimmedStr中。
相关问题
c# string 填充空格
可以使用 String.PadRight() 或 String.PadLeft() 方法来填充空格。
例如,如果要将字符串 s 填充到长度为 n,则可以使用以下代码:
```csharp
string paddedString = s.PadRight(n);
```
这将在字符串 s 的末尾填充空格,直到字符串长度达到 n。
如果要在字符串 s 的开头填充空格,则可以使用 PadLeft() 方法:
```csharp
string paddedString = s.PadLeft(n);
```
这将在字符串 s 的开头填充空格,直到字符串长度达到 n。
C# 字符串去除空格
在 C# 中,你可以使用 `Trim()` 方法去除字符串的前导和尾部的空格。如果你想要去除字符串中所有的空格,你可以使用 `Replace()` 方法将空格替换为空字符串。以下是一个示例:
```csharp
string str = " Hello, World! ";
string trimmedStr = str.Trim(); // 去除前导和尾部的空格
string noSpaceStr = str.Replace(" ", ""); // 去除所有空格
Console.WriteLine(trimmedStr);
Console.WriteLine(noSpaceStr);
```
输出结果:
```
Hello, World!
Hello,World!
```
希望这能帮到你!如果你还有其他问题,请随时问我。